# sanguo_data/datafeed.py
import pandas as pd
import urllib.request
import json
import time
import logging
from datetime import datetime, timedelta
from multiprocessing import Process, Queue
from typing import Optional
from sanguo_data.config import DataConfig
logger = logging.getLogger(__name__)
def fetch_with_fallback(symbol, start, end, sources: list[str]) -> pd.DataFrame:
fetchers = {
"eastmoney": _fetch_eastmoney,
"baostock": lambda s, st, e: _fetch_baostock_with_timeout(s, st, e, timeout=30),
"tencent": _fetch_tencent,
}
last_err = None
for name in sources:
try:
df = fetchers[name](symbol, start, end)
if df is not None and len(df) > 0:
return df
except Exception as e:
last_err = e
continue
raise RuntimeError(f"all sources failed: {last_err}")
def fetch_daily(symbol, start, end, cfg: DataConfig) -> pd.DataFrame:
sources = [s["name"] for s in cfg.data_sources.get("daily", []) if s.get("enabled", True)]
return fetch_with_fallback(symbol, start, end, sources)
# Worker function for multiprocessing (must be at module level to be picklable)
def _baostock_worker(symbol, start, end, result_queue):
try:
result = _fetch_baostock_raw(symbol, start, end)
result_queue.put(result)
except Exception as e:
result_queue.put(e)
# Test helper for timeout testing (simulates hanging BaoStock call)
def _hanging_worker_for_test(symbol, start, end, result_queue):
"""Test helper: simulates a hanging BaoStock call (60s sleep)"""
import time as _time
_time.sleep(60)
result_queue.put(pd.DataFrame({"date": ["2026-01-01"], "open": [10.0]}))
def _fetch_baostock_with_timeout(symbol, start, end, timeout=30):
"""子进程隔离 BaoStock(修复 v1 无超时卡死坑)"""
result_queue = Queue()
p = Process(target=_baostock_worker, args=(symbol, start, end, result_queue))
p.start()
p.join(timeout)
if p.is_alive():
p.terminate()
p.join()
raise TimeoutError(f"baostock timeout after {timeout}s")
res = result_queue.get()
if isinstance(res, Exception):
raise res
return res
def _get_em_secid(code: str) -> str:
if code.startswith(("60", "68", "51")):
return f"1.{code}"
return f"0.{code}"
def _parse_em_klines(klines: list) -> Optional[pd.DataFrame]:
"""解析东方财富K线数据(日线和15min通用)"""
if not klines:
return None
rows = []
for line in klines:
parts = line.split(",")
if len(parts) < 7:
continue
rows.append({
"date": parts[0],
"open": float(parts[1]),
"close": float(parts[2]),
"high": float(parts[3]),
"low": float(parts[4]),
"volume": float(parts[5]),
"amount": float(parts[6]),
})
if not rows:
return None
return pd.DataFrame(rows)
def _fetch_baostock_raw(symbol: str, start_date: str, end_date: str) -> Optional[pd.DataFrame]:
"""BaoStock日线:全量历史,无反爬,amount真实,T+1延迟
Copied from v1 data_platform/daily_all_update.py:fetch_baostock_daily (lines 242-270)
"""
try:
import baostock as bs
except ImportError:
return None
# 转换代码格式:600000 -> sh.600000
code = symbol.replace("SH", "").replace("SZ", "").replace("sh", "").replace("sz", "")
if code.startswith(("60", "68", "51")):
bs_code = f"sh.{code}"
else:
bs_code = f"sz.{code}"
try:
rs = bs.query_history_k_data_plus(
bs_code,
"date,open,high,low,close,volume,amount",
start_date=start_date.replace("-", ""),
end_date=end_date.replace("-", ""),
frequency="d",
adjustflag="2",
)
rows = []
while (rs.error_code == "0") and rs.next():
rows.append(rs.get_row_data())
if not rows:
return None
df = pd.DataFrame(rows, columns=["date", "open", "high", "low", "close", "volume", "amount"])
for c in ["open", "high", "low", "close", "volume", "amount"]:
df[c] = pd.to_numeric(df[c], errors="coerce")
df = df.dropna(subset=["close"])
if df.empty:
return None
return df
except Exception as e:
logger.debug("BaoStock日线失败 %s: %s", symbol, e)
return None
def _fetch_eastmoney(symbol: str, start_date: str, end_date: str) -> Optional[pd.DataFrame]:
"""东方财富日线:当天实时,amount真实,4s限频
Copied from v1 data_platform/daily_all_update.py:fetch_eastmoney_daily (lines 339-374)
"""
try:
import requests as _requests
except ImportError:
return None
code = symbol.replace("SH", "").replace("SZ", "").replace("sh", "").replace("sz", "")
secid = _get_em_secid(code)
ts = str(int(time.time() * 1000))
url = (
f"https://push2his.eastmoney.com/api/qt/stock/kline/get?"
f"secid={secid}&klt=101&fqt=1&"
f"beg={start_date.replace('-', '')}&end={end_date.replace('-', '')}&"
f"fields1=f1,f2,f3,f4,f5,f6,f7,f8&"
f"fields2=f51,f52,f53,f54,f55,f56,f57,f58,f59,f60,f61&"
f"ut=b2884a393a59ad64002292a3e90d46a5&lmt=10000&"
f"cb=jQuery_em_{ts}&_={ts}"
)
headers_em = {
"User-Agent": "Mozilla/5.0 (Windows NT 10.0; Win64; x64) AppleWebKit/537.36 (KHTML, like Gecko) Chrome/124.0.0.0 Safari/537.36",
"Referer": "https://quote.eastmoney.com/",
"Accept": "*/*",
"Accept-Language": "zh-CN,zh;q=0.9",
}
session = _requests.Session()
session.trust_env = False
try:
r = session.get(url, headers=headers_em, timeout=15, verify=False)
if r.status_code != 200:
return None
text = r.text
data = json.loads(text[text.index("(") + 1:text.rindex(")")])
if data.get("rc") != 0:
return None
klines = data.get("data", {}).get("klines", [])
df = _parse_em_klines(klines)
if df is None:
return None
df["date"] = pd.to_datetime(df["date"]).dt.strftime("%Y-%m-%d")
mask = (df["date"] >= start_date) & (df["date"] <= end_date)
result = df.loc[mask, ["date", "open", "high", "low", "close", "volume", "amount"]]
return result if not result.empty else None
except Exception as e:
logger.debug("东方财富日线失败 %s: %s", symbol, e)
return None
def _fetch_tencent(symbol: str, start_date: str, end_date: str) -> Optional[pd.DataFrame]:
"""腾讯日线:amount有时为0
Copied from v1 data_platform/fallback.py:_fetch_tencent_daily (lines 66-104)
"""
code = symbol.replace("SH", "").replace("SZ", "").replace("sh", "").replace("sz", "")
if code.startswith(("6", "5", "1")):
prefix = "sh"
else:
prefix = "sz"
tq_symbol = f"{prefix}{code}"
days = (datetime.strptime(end_date, "%Y-%m-%d") - datetime.strptime(start_date, "%Y-%m-%d")).days + 10
url = f"https://web.ifzq.gtimg.cn/appstock/app/fqkline/get?param={tq_symbol},day,{start_date},,{days},"
opener = urllib.request.build_opener(urllib.request.ProxyHandler({}))
try:
req = urllib.request.Request(url, headers={"User-Agent": "Mozilla/5.0"})
with opener.open(req, timeout=10) as r:
resp = json.loads(r.read())
d = resp.get("data")
if not isinstance(d, dict):
return None
klines = d.get(tq_symbol, {}).get("day", [])
if not klines:
return None
df = pd.DataFrame(klines)
ncols = len(df.columns)
if ncols >= 7:
df.columns = ["date", "open", "close", "high", "low", "volume", "amount"][:ncols]
else:
df.columns = ["date", "open", "close", "high", "low", "volume"][:ncols]
if "amount" not in df.columns:
df["amount"] = 0.0
for c in ["open", "close", "high", "low", "volume", "amount"]:
df[c] = pd.to_numeric(df[c], errors="coerce").fillna(0)
df["date"] = pd.to_datetime(df["date"]).dt.strftime("%Y-%m-%d")
mask = (df["date"] >= start_date) & (df["date"] <= end_date)
return df.loc[mask, ["date", "open", "high", "low", "close", "volume", "amount"]]
except Exception as e:
logger.debug("腾讯日线失败 %s: %s", symbol, e)
return None
